@larry29 Another out-of-the-box idea -
I had spinal pain in my neck, it turned out to be "referred" from knots in the upper back muscles, trapping/irritating nerves. I know the last thing we want to do when in serious pain is PT, but I was desperate. It took a rehab physical therapist ( I was referred by my pain rehab clinic) working gradually with myofascial release (MFR) and other manipulations, plus gentle stretching and work on my part, to break the cycle.
You usually find such a PT through your docs, and they are not the same people who oversee post-surgical protocols, they are a last resort when everyone else gives up.

Have you tried physical therapy?
